@font-face{font-family:"Aspira W01 Bold";font-display:swap;src:url("/Fonts/a44c0664-78c9-413d-9f9c-bf76ce75c457.eot?#iefix");src:url("/Fonts/a44c0664-78c9-413d-9f9c-bf76ce75c457.eot?#iefix") format("eot"),url("/Fonts/1d81afc9-e394-4ef4-b8d7-6fe075e6aa6f.woff2") format("woff2"),url("/Fonts/73551e42-3b0c-46fa-aad5-8d0661d05e1a.woff") format("woff"),url("/Fonts/bd9c5ed5-7acb-44ad-8de0-faa787dc3571.ttf") format("truetype")}.firstgray-section{margin-bottom:180px}.firstgray-section__inner{max-width:1180px;margin:0 auto;padding:0 20px}.firstgray-fs14{font-size:1.4rem}.firstgray-fs13{font-size:1.3rem}.firstgray-recommendation-list{margin-top:90px}.firstgray-recommendation-list .round-panel{padding:20px;word-break:keep-all}.firstgray-recommendation-list .round-panel__text{padding:20px;font-weight:600;font-size:clamp(1.4rem, 5vw, 2.2rem)}.firstgray-recommendation-list .grid-relative__inner{margin:0 max(-22px, -1vw)}.firstgray-recommendation-list .grid-relative__item{padding:0 min(22px, 1vw)}.firstgray-step{margin:0 -50px 0 0}.firstgray-step .btn-common{display:block;width:-webkit-fit-content;width:fit-content;margin-right:auto;margin-left:auto}.firstgray-step .grid-relative__item{padding:0 50px 0 0;background-image:url("/common/img/icon/icon-arrow-to-right.svg");background-position:top 25% right 3%;background-repeat:no-repeat}.firstgray-step .grid-relative__item:last-child{background:none}.firstgray-step__text{display:flex;color:#636363;font-size:1.5rem;line-height:1.5}.firstgray-step__num{display:flex;align-items:center;justify-content:center;min-width:50px;height:50px;margin-top:7px;border-radius:50%;background-color:#4d4398;color:#fff;font-size:3rem;font-family:"Aspira W01 Bold",sans-serif}main>:first-child.firstgray-section{position:relative}@media screen and (min-width: 769px){main>:first-child.firstgray-section{margin-bottom:100px;padding-top:110px;padding-bottom:80px}main>:first-child.firstgray-section .hdg-l1{margin-bottom:80px}main>:first-child.firstgray-section::after{content:"";position:absolute;top:0;right:0;z-index:-1;display:block;width:max(50%, 900px);height:60%;background-image:url("/topics/firstgray/img/firstgray-img-01.jpg");background-position:top 0 right;background-size:contain;background-repeat:no-repeat;transform:translateY(60%)}}@media screen and (max-width: 1400px){.firstgray-section__inner{padding:0 70px}}@media screen and (max-width: 768px){.firstgray-section{margin-bottom:40px}.firstgray-recommendation-list{margin-top:20px}.firstgray-recommendation-list .grid-relative__inner{margin:calc(-15px / 2)}.firstgray-recommendation-list .grid-relative__item{padding:calc(15px / 2)}.firstgray-recipe-layout.grid-relative__inner{flex-direction:column}.firstgray-recipe-layout.grid-relative__inner .grid-relative__item{width:100%;padding:20px 0;border-top:solid 1px #636363;border-left:none}.firstgray-recipe-layout.grid-relative__inner .grid-relative__item:last-child{border-right:none;border-bottom:solid 1px #636363}.firstgray-step{margin:0 0 -120px 0}.firstgray-step .grid-relative__item{width:100%;padding:0 0 120px 0;background-image:url("/common/img/icon/icon-arrow-to-bottom.svg");background-position:bottom 11% center;background-repeat:no-repeat}.firstgray-step .grid-relative__item:last-child{background:none}.firstgray-section__inner{padding:0 20px}main>:first-child.firstgray-section{margin-bottom:0;padding-top:35px;padding-bottom:40px;background-image:url("/topics/firstgray/img/firstgray-img-01_sp.jpg");background-position:center center;background-size:100%;background-repeat:no-repeat}main>:first-child.firstgray-section .hdg-l1{margin-bottom:90vw}}
